Lets say I have a company with around 20 people that all have their own workstation that I would want to monitor. For example, see when their RAM is getting too high, or when their C: is getting too full, will I have to add them all manually?
Because if you want to add a workstation you'd have to supply the software with each user's own username and password. How would I do that if I would want to monitor 60 different servers?

You can use the auto-discovery to discover a list of devices. You can find it in the settings of a group in PRTG.
Are the workstations part of a domain? If so, you can use an AD user in the "Credentials for Windows Devices" in the settings of the group. If not, you can take a look at this article for the WMI requirements for workstations which are not part of a domain: https://helpdesk.paessler.com/en/support/solutions/articles/75435-logging-in-to-wmi-in-a-non-domain-network
